In today's fast-paced world, where technology and data play a crucial role in decision-making, understanding the concept of a reliability index system is essential. A reliability index system refers to a framework or methodology used to evaluate and quantify the reliability of various systems, products, or services. This system provides a numerical value or index that reflects the level of trustworthiness, performance, and consistency of an entity over time.The importance of a reliability index system cannot be overstated, especially in industries such as manufacturing, transportation, and information technology. For instance, in manufacturing, companies rely on this system to assess the durability and performance of their products. By analyzing historical data and failure rates, manufacturers can develop a reliability index system that helps them identify potential issues before they become significant problems. This proactive approach not only enhances product quality but also improves customer satisfaction and loyalty.In the realm of transportation, a reliability index system is vital for ensuring safety and efficiency. Airlines, for example, utilize this system to monitor the reliability of their aircraft. By evaluating factors such as maintenance records, flight delays, and incident reports, airlines can assign a reliability score to each aircraft. This score aids in decision-making regarding maintenance schedules, fleet management, and even the purchase of new aircraft. Consequently, passengers can have greater confidence in the safety of their flights, knowing that airlines are committed to maintaining high reliability standards.Furthermore, in the field of information technology, a reliability index system plays a crucial role in evaluating software applications and IT infrastructure. As businesses increasingly rely on digital solutions, the need for reliable systems becomes paramount. By implementing a reliability index system, organizations can assess the performance and uptime of their software applications, ensuring that they meet the demands of users. This system allows IT teams to identify bottlenecks, optimize performance, and enhance user experience, ultimately leading to increased productivity and reduced downtime.Moreover, the development of a reliability index system requires collaboration among various stakeholders. Engineers, data analysts, and quality assurance teams must work together to gather data, analyze trends, and establish benchmarks for reliability. This collaborative effort ensures that the system is comprehensive and accurately reflects the performance of the entity being evaluated.In conclusion, the reliability index system is a powerful tool that enables organizations to assess and improve the reliability of their products, services, and systems. By providing a quantifiable measure of trustworthiness, this system empowers businesses to make informed decisions, enhance customer satisfaction, and maintain a competitive edge. As industries continue to evolve and technology advances, the significance of a reliability index system will only grow, making it an indispensable component of modern operations.Overall, understanding the reliability index system is crucial for anyone involved in decision-making processes across various sectors. It not only aids in risk management but also fosters a culture of continuous improvement, where organizations strive to enhance their reliability and performance consistently.
